WebJan 27, 2016 · Activities at The Tinkering Studio A highlight at The Tinkering Studio is the Marble Machine. Against a peg wall, kids can get fiddly with an assortment of everyday objects that include vacuum hoses and funnels as they build a path to direct a marble on a journey down the 13.6 square metre wall.
